Crispy Onions in an Air Fryer

Using an air fryer for making crispy onions provides a healthier alternative to traditional frying methods by reducing the need for excessive oil. The air fryer circulates hot air evenly around the food, which helps create a crunchy texture without the calories or mess associated with deep-frying.

Essential Ingredients

To achieve that irresistible crunch, you’ll need the following ingredients:

– **Onions:** Yellow or white onions work best for frying. Slice thinly for the crispiest texture.
– **Flour or Cornstarch:** Lightly coating the onion rings ensures a crispy texture.
– **Seasonings:** Common choices include salt, pepper, paprika, or garlic powder.
– **Oil Spray:** A minimal amount is used to enhance browning and crispiness.

## Step-by-Step Preparation Guide

### 1. Slice the Onions

Cut the onions into thin, even rings to ensure uniform cooking. Thinner slices yield crispier results, while thicker rings create a softer texture.

### 2. Prepare the Coating

In a large bowl, combine flour, cornstarch, and your preferred seasonings. Mixing these ingredients thoroughly ensures every onion ring is coated evenly.

### 3. Coat the Onion Rings

Toss the sliced onions in the flour mixture until each ring is evenly coated. For a gluten-free version, replace flour with rice flour or almond flour.

### 4. Preheat the Air Fryer

Set your air fryer to 375°F (190°C) and allow it to preheat for about 3 minutes. Preheating helps achieve a consistent temperature, essential for achieving the perfect crisp.

### 5. Arrange and Spray

Place the coated onion rings in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Avoid overcrowding, as this can lead to uneven cooking. Lightly spray the onions with oil to enhance the crispy texture.

## Ideal Cooking Time and Temperature

The ideal temperature for air-frying onions is 375°F (190°C), and the cooking time ranges between **8-12 minutes**. Check the onions halfway through and shake the basket to ensure even cooking.

Seasoning Variations

### Classic Seasoned Crispy Onions
– **Ingredients:** Salt, pepper, paprika, and garlic powder.
– **Instructions:** Add these spices to the flour mixture before coating the onions for a traditional flavor profile.

### Spicy Crispy Onions
– **Ingredients:** Cayenne pepper, smoked paprika, and black pepper.
– **Instructions:** Incorporate the spices into the flour mix to give the onions a spicy kick.

### Herb-Infused Crispy Onions
– **Ingredients:** Dried oregano, basil, or rosemary.
– **Instructions:** Add dried herbs to the coating mix for an aromatic flavor that pairs well with roasted vegetables and pasta dishes.

Serving Suggestions

Crispy onions made in an air fryer are a versatile topping that can be used in countless ways:

1. **Burgers and Sandwiches:** Add a layer of crunch and flavor to your favorite burgers or sandwiches.
2. **Salads:** Sprinkle crispy onions over salads for added texture.
3. **Casseroles:** Use as a topping for casseroles to bring a satisfying crunch to each bite.
4. **Soups:** Add a few crispy onions on top of soups, particularly French onion or creamy mushroom soup.

## Storage and Reheating Tips

– **Storage:** Store leftover crispy onions in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days.
– **Reheating:** For best results, reheat in the air fryer at 300°F (150°C) for 3-5 minutes to restore crispiness.
